Output 2e0c67ccd35281789f03644d2e0d422913aa323019e813ab47a20c0f42d5e96b:2

value
50441679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46dad53f477bae2dd9c76fd7648da8f7ee256e45 OP_EQUAL
address
MEMogeAEoDkahD3or9Q2WbVymupAc6DpjG
transaction
2e0c67ccd35281789f03644d2e0d422913aa323019e813ab47a20c0f42d5e96b
spent
true